Two-face wants more superhero action. by Orlando Parfitt <http://movies. ign.com/email. html> , IGN UK UK, July 4, 2008 - Aaron Eckhart - AKA Harvey Dent/Two-Face in The Dark Knight - has been blabbing this week about wanting to swap super-villainy for super-heroism in his next role. When asked by iFMagazine <http://www.ifmagazi ne.com/new. asp?article= 6438> if he would be up for donning spandex in the future, he said: "Is it for me? Are you nuts. I want my piece." He also had this to say about the rumours he might be in the running for Captain America: "I don't know, I'm getting older - I don't know if there are any old superheroes. " When reminded of Robert Downey Jr. in Iron Man, he said "That's true, bas**rd!" Instead, its D.C.'s The Green Lantern that he's a fan of: "I've forgotten his characteristics and what he does, but I remember liking the Green Lantern a lot." No matter which character he plays, he's definitely open to making another superhero adaptation after his experiences on The Dark Knight. "I would, because they're fun to do," says Eckhart. "I had fun doing this movie. I like action in general. I like to run around and be on cool motorcycles. I always get a tinge of jealousy when I see it and I'm not in it. I don't know what's left.
